I think you should change a bit you business plan, ads won't sustain the costs. I dont see why anyone would provide you a server without getting the same value in ads in return.
Users that go to your website, will mostly be kids that wanna play a game with friends, they are not looking to buy dedicated servers. Hence the ads won't bring revenue to the sponsors.
Create a members area. Allow 10 minute trials, without registration. Give 1 day for free, for registered , after that the server is reset (all progress in-game is lost). Ask for a small payment (paypal or CC) to keep the server running, or ask the user to complete x amount of surveys (since kids wont just take their parents CC most of the time) , according on the amount of used resources.
Also, create a product separate from the others where they own an entire dedicated server and you configure it for them. if the dedi costs like 50$, charge them from $75 to $100 or more...
Have your own servers, pay for them, and run google adsense. Advertise on forums about your 1 day free servers. Make users register. Throw a follow-up email campaign for a week giving discounts higher and higher until they buy from you. Convert them from prospects to customers.
Try to charge the next month payment 7 days before the server expires, if the payment fails send an automatic email to them saying that the payment failed and to update their information. This will reduce churn.
Create some referring affiliate program, where you pay them to refer their friends, or give extra time for servers.
